Dream of the Red Chamber was a classic in Chinese classical literature. The description of scenery was an indispensable part of the novel. In novels, the description of scenery can show the scene, atmosphere, emotion and so on, which has many aesthetic functions. The characteristics of the scenery descriptions in Dream of the Red Chamber mainly included the following aspects: The description of the scenery in the novel is very delicate. By describing the living environment, climate, scenery, etc. of the characters, the emotional state and psychological changes of the characters are vividly displayed. 2. Rich and colorful: The description of the scenery in the novel is very rich. Through the description of different scenes, buildings, vegetation, etc., the different regional customs are vividly displayed. 3. Creating an atmosphere: The description of the scenery in the novel can create a different atmosphere. For example, the description of the scenery in spring can make the readers feel vitality and hope. The description of the scenery in autumn can make the readers feel mature and bleak. 4. Prominent character: The description of the scenery in Dream of the Red Chamber not only shows the living environment and psychological state of different characters, but also highlights the character characteristics of the characters through the description of the scenery, such as Lin Daiyu's sensitivity, Baochai's dignity, etc. The aesthetic function of the scenery description in Dream of the Red Chamber was very rich. Through the scenery description, the readers could feel different regional customs, emotional states and characters. At the same time, it could also improve the literary and artistic value of the novel.

The function of the scenery description at the beginning of Blessing is

1 answer
2024-09-08 16:08

Blessing was Lu Xun's novel. The description of the scenery at the beginning of the novel created a desolate atmosphere, allowing the readers to feel the grief and loneliness in the author's heart more deeply. By describing the desolation and ruin of the village, the readers could feel the great influence brought by the changes of the times and the vile and helpless environment of the protagonist. At the same time, this kind of description could also lay down the foreshadowing of the protagonist's encounter and life after the encounter, making the readers look forward to the development of the plot. In addition, the description of the scenery could also provide the reader with emotional resonance, allowing the reader to feel the feelings of the protagonist more deeply. For example, the loneliness and helplessness of the protagonist in the novel can be described more deeply through the desolation and ruin of the village. The reader can resonate with the protagonist and feel his inner pain and loneliness.
